Challenges in Injecting Patients with Obesity
Patients with obesity often have increased subcutaneous fat, which can make standard injection techniques less effective. Common issues include:
- Difficulty reaching the target tissue
- Increased risk of injecting into fat rather than muscle
- Potential for inconsistent absorption of medication
Adjustments in Injection Technique
To address these challenges, healthcare providers should consider the following adjustments:
- Use Longer Needles: Select needle lengths appropriate for increased subcutaneous fat, typically 1.5 inches or longer for intramuscular injections.
- Adjust Injection Angle: Change the angle of insertion to 90 degrees for intramuscular injections, or 45 degrees for subcutaneous injections, depending on the patient’s body habitus.
- Identify Proper Landmarks: Ensure accurate identification of anatomical landmarks to target the correct tissue layer.
- Consider Ultrasound Guidance: In complex cases, ultrasound can help visualize tissue layers and guide injections.
Best Practices for Safe and Effective Injections
Implementing best practices can improve injection success rates:
- Assess each patient’s body composition carefully before selecting injection technique.
- Use the shortest effective needle length for subcutaneous injections to minimize discomfort and ensure proper delivery.
- Educate patients about the importance of proper injection sites and techniques.
- Document the chosen technique and any adjustments made for future reference.
